Poly Plasticine Clay is a non-hardening, sulfur-free modeling clay that has many uses in mold making and casting. Learn more about its versatility here:

Common reasons fillers are added to polyurethane products like EasyFlo and Poly 15 Series Liquid Plastics include cost reduction, to help dissipate exotherm, and to achieve a different look or weight. More information on types of fillers here: https://t.co/6VaBuf6Mor
